Output 041b163d6c825d57bae80a786f44161942611d69a45f003df6ded81ffc515232:0

value
253707646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 648286957a76352532bee353c3de58a8efb6bfad OP_EQUAL
address
3ArTrp6B1EfDnSSw89t9YuHVkUgVHBc1gq
transaction
041b163d6c825d57bae80a786f44161942611d69a45f003df6ded81ffc515232
confirmations
524032
spent
true